[QUOTE="ORVietVet, post: 22595, member: 9438"] Welcome to the forum from Oregon. Glad you are here. I do believe you have answered your own concerns. Do you remember/know when the last time you did the fluid services on the diffs and transfer case? Especially on an AWD truck, it is important. Have you owned a long time and know when did the services or did you buy used and have never done services and did you get maintenance/repairs paperwork when you bought the truck? When turning, the inner wheel turns different revolution counts than the outside wheel and it all has to be transferred inside the cases and diffs. If you got metal, you got problems.
